  • Publication number: 20230343446
    Abstract: Methods, systems, and apparatus, including computer programs encoded on a computer storage medium, for generating a respective response score for each of a plurality of patient categories. In one aspect, a method comprises: generating a drug signature for a drug; generating an embedding of the drug signature in a latent space; and processing: (i) the embedding of the drug signature in the latent space, and (ii) data defining a plurality of patient categories, to generate a plurality of response scores, wherein each response score corresponds to a respective patient category and characterizes a predicted response of patients included in the patient category to the drug.
